Here are a few recommended paid courses that many industry professionals have found invaluable:

  1. B2B Content Marketing Certification by HubSpot
    HubSpot offers an in-depth certification program that addresses the nuances of B2B content marketing. This course covers everything from crafting compelling content to understanding the buyer’s journey, making it a solid investment for anyone looking to enhance their skills.

  2. Content Marketing Masterclass by Udemy
    This masterclass provides a well-rounded exploration of content marketing tactics, including specific strategies for B2B businesses. The course is detailed and offers actionable insights, ensuring you walk away with practical knowledge you can implement immediately.

  3. B2B Content Marketing Strategy by LinkedIn Learning
    This course dives into the unique aspects of B2B content marketing and is tailored for professionals looking to make a significant impact in their field. It covers strategy development, content creation, and distribution techniques that resonate specifically with business clients.

  4. Content Marketing Certification by the Content Marketing Institute
    The CMI offers an extensive content marketing certification that, while not exclusively B2B, includes modules that emphasize B2B strategies. Itโ€™s led by experts in the field and provides a plethora of resources to assist you in mastering content marketing principles.

    Practical Advice:

    • Focus on Case Studies: When selecting a course, inquire about the inclusion of case studies or real-world examples, especially those centered around B2B marketing. This will enhance your understanding of practical applications and how to overcome challenges specific to B2B.

    • Utilize Networking: Many of these courses come with dedicated forums or community groups. Engaging with fellow learners can provide additional insights and connections that may help further your career and knowledge in B2B content marketing.

    • Take Action: As you learn, implement the strategies into your current marketing efforts. Measurement and adaptation are vital; which B2B content tactics work for your business may differ based on your audience, so stay flexible and willing to iterate as you gain experience.
